DISTANT SECRET – Laid in approaching the 300m tightening MOVE BEYOND. Jockey A. Thompson was advised to exercise greater care. Inconvenienced and bumped approaching the 100m.
 
MY MOSES – Bumped the running rail approaching the 900m. Raced keenly on heels from the 600m to the 500m. After improving onto heels shifted out abruptly approaching the 100m to obtain clear running. Apprentice S. Callow pleaded guilty to a charge of careless riding AR131(a) in that she did allow her mount to shift out causing SIR BEVERIDGE to be checked and shift out bumping with DISTANT SECRET. App S. Callow’s license to ride in races was suspended for a period of 13 days, commencing from 25 June 2023 up to 8 July 2023. In determining penalty Stewards determined the degree of carelessness and severity of interference to be in the mid-range. Stewards also noted App Callows guilty plea as well as her poor recent record in relation to the rule. App Callow was advised of her right to an appeal.

REBEL LASS – Declared a late scratching at 7:14pm when the filly refused to proceed to the start. Prior to the declaration of correct weight all monies invested on the filly were ordered to be refunded with the following deductions applicable to all successful wagers placed prior to 7:14pm:
 
2cents in the dollar for the win
7cents in the dollar for the place on the winner
2cents in the dollar for 2nd place
2cents in the dollar for 3rd place
 
Trainer K. Kemp advised connections would now consider retiring the filly, nonetheless Mr Kemp was advised the filly would be required to trial prior to racing again.
